Utrecht lost 5-1, Oar subbed off on 82' after providing the assist for the hosts' only goal. Poor result but they were up against it as their right back conceded a penalty and was sent off on 22' with Utrecht already 1-0 down.

Mat Ryan played a full 90 as Club Bruges drew 2-2 with Gent. Oscar Duarte was sent off for Bruges on 52' with the team 2-1 up.

Sainsbury subbed on at 70' for PEC Zwolle with his team 2-1 down at home, his partner in defence then equalised five minutes later as it finished 2-2.

Hmm yeah, Alex Grant is an exciting, unsung, prospect. Always tracking well at younger ages, exposed to senior football early. Always one I hoped would enter the youth NT's set up, given our ever questionable defences every generation of the past few! He seemed a valued talent, when snapped up by Stoke, so hopefully that comes through via this loan opportunity. He being a 1994-born talent means he can quality for the coming Olyroos generation, so if he's seeing more regular senior football exposure by the time of those qualifiers, then no reason why he can't force himself into consideration, atleast. But it needs to start here, at this level and work his way to featuring at a slightly higher level. Or else he won't deserve a look-in ahead of the likes of Curtis Good, Cameron Burgess, Connor Chapman, James Donachie, Jordan Elsey and others.
